Ice hockey league champions Salzburg sign their second new addition with an experienced center from Ingolstadt. Strengths above all at the point.
With Drake Rymsha and Nicolai Meyer, the Ice Bulls have recently seen two departures, but now the forward ranks of the Ice Hockey League champions are being replenished.
Salzburg has strengthened its ranks with the addition of two-way center Andrew Rowe. The 36-year-old American has many years of experience in Sweden, Germany and Switzerland. Last season, the bullying specialist recorded 23 points (14 goals, 9 assists) from 44 games for Ingolstadt. However, with a plus-minus statistic of -11, there is still plenty of room for improvement.
"I'm thrilled to be part of such a professional organization. I'm looking forward to joining the team and getting to work," says the rookie ice cop.
